#58e94a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#58e94a is composed of 34.5% red, 91.4%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.2%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 114.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 60.2%. #58e94a color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ff94 with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#58e94a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b01 is the darkest color, while #f9f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#58e94a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989b98 is the less saturated color, while #4bf93a is the most saturated one.
